OpenAction Plugin Registry

This repository serves as the official registry and catalogue for OpenAction plugins.

Project Structure

  • catalogue.json: The central registry file containing metadata for all available plugins.
  • icons/: A directory containing the formatted icons for the plugins.
  • format_icons.py & update_descriptions.py: Python utility scripts used for maintaining the registry, fetching updates, and formatting assets.
  • pyproject.toml: Python project configuration and dependencies for the utility scripts.

Submitting a Plugin

To submit your plugin to the OpenAction Marketplace, please follow these steps:

  1. Add the Repository Tag: Add the openaction topic/tag to your plugin's repository on GitHub.

  2. Update the Catalogue: Fork this repository and add an entry for your plugin to the catalogue.json file.

    • The key should be your plugin's bundle ID.
    • The name and author fields must exactly match the values in your plugin's manifest file.
    • The description field should match the sidebar description of your plugin's GitHub repository.
  3. Correct Placement: Ensure your entry is added to the correct logical section in catalogue.json. The catalog is organized in the following order:

    1. Official plugins from the OpenAction project
    2. Native OpenAction plugins (probably where you want to add your plugin)
    3. Device support plugins
    4. Open-source Stream Deck plugins

    Note: Within each individual section, plugins are sorted alphabetically by their GitHub repository URL.

  4. Add an Icon: Add a high-resolution icon representing your plugin to the icons/ directory. The icon should match the icon provided in your plugin's manifest / bundle. The file should be named matching your plugin's bundle ID (e.g. com.yourname.plugin.png). Note: You do not need to run the format_icons.py script yourself; a maintainer will run it in a standardised environment to format your icon when reviewing your submission.

Once you have added your entry to the appropriate section, submit a Pull Request to this repository for review.

Alternative Method (The Easy Way)

If you prefer an easier route, simply get in contact with us via Matrix, Discord, or by opening a GitHub Issue in this repository. Drop your plugin's repository URL, and a maintainer will add the plugin for you!
